MLC vs SYD Dream11: Melbourne City FC and Sydney FC are all set to resume their rivalry as they lock horns against each other on Wednesday. Melbourne City FC are in good form at the moment, having won three consecutive games, which has propelled them to the top of the points table with 43 points to their name. Moreover, they also have two games in hand over second placed, Western United. Sydney defeated Wanderers in their last fixture by a score-line of 3-2. Although, they have claimed three wins from their last five games, they are still placed on the fifth spot with 28 points to their name.

Head to Head

From the last five meetings between the two sides, three games have been won by Melbourne City FC. One game has been won by Sydney FC, whereas, the other has ended in a draw.
